I stand by that WildStar still offers some of the best content in any MMO. It’s raids and dungeons are without question, the best in the genre. Combined with the recent changes to daily activities, loot, raid attunements and much more, I’d argue that WildStar is in the best state its ever been. There’s still a lot to do, certainly in terms of PvP and getting players back onto PvP servers and there’s always the need for more content. The only risk I see to the game going free to play is the introduction of yet more currencies, a complicated tier system between signature and free to play and the best cosmetic items placed onto the store. Looking at the list, I never understand why they want to neuter the play experience so much. Having said that, I think the positives of WildStar going free to play far outweigh the negatives. It’ll bring in a new audience, bring back old players and most importantly, increase revenue as the shift to free to play always do.
